Chalk streams are among the world's rarest river habitats. Fewer than 300 exist globally, and most are found in England. They support rich wildlife and have been described as England's 'Great Barrier Reef' due to their biodiversity. But they face pressure from climate change and other long-term impacts including pollution and water abstraction. Professor Rachel Stubbington of Nottingham Trent University's School of Science and Technology explains what makes chalk streams unique, why they are important and what can be done to protect them.

Controlling the rotation direction of light without complex new materials

A new pathway has opened for controlling the rotation direction of light simply by changing how molecules are arranged, without having to synthesize complex new materials. Circularly polarized light is a special form of light that travels while rotating like a pinwheel to the left or right. Because different rotation directions can carry different information, it is drawing attention as a key light source for next-generation displays, optical communications and security technologies.
